It could be a bad connection with the common yellow, but I'd check the
normally closed contacts in the Motor Relay, and in the 2nd Ball Relay.
If there's two 2nd Ball Relays (A & B), it's probably in 'A' that circuit flows
through, but it wouldn't hurt to check both the closed contacts (when in the
reset position) in both A & B 2nd Ball Relays.
